Court costs and other litigation costs

In complicated cases, Injury Lawyers the costs of injury lawyers can be high. They include legal fees, administrative expenses and expert witness costs and disbursements. Some of these costs can't be eliminated.

Attorney's fees can range from hundreds of dollars to thousands. In addition to attorney's fees, you may be charged expert witness fees as well as court reporter fees or transcripts, as well as travel expenses. You may need to hire an accident reconstructionist, doctor or other expert to defend your case. Based on the degree of your injuries you may pay hundreds of dollars for the investigation, deposition, and trial preparation.

Other expenses could include the costs of copying documents and sending them by fax. Law firms typically track copies and faxes and charge clients for each one. A transcript could cost anywhere between $2 and $4 per page.
